  • Episode 60: Shivendra Kumar - Recap of 2024 | The Competitive Contractor Podcast
    In this special year-end episode of the Competitive Contractor Podcast, we reflect on the key highlights and industry insights shared throughout 2024. From digital transformations in projects like Cross River Rail to the growing role of BIM and automation, we’ve explored how the industry is evolving. We’ve also covered modern procurement practices, sustainability in urban planning, and the importance of collaboration through joint ventures. As we look ahead, we discuss the critical need for crisis recovery planning in an unpredictable world.   • Episode 59: Jon Davies - From the Podium to Practise - The 2024 Journey | The Competitive Contractor Podcast
    Look into the current challenges and transformations within the Australian Construction Industry. Jon Davies, CEO of the Australian Constructors Association (ACA), explores the association's focus on enhancing industrial relations, addressing skill shortages, managing supply chain disruptions, and tackling cost escalation issues.   He also touches on the National Construction Industry Forum's role in fostering dialogue between government, industry, and unions to align objectives and streamline efforts across various industry challenges.  The episode concludes with insightful discussions around the importance of maintaining a healthy industry culture to attract and retain talent, enhance productivity, and ensure the well-being of workers.    #AustralianConstruction #IndustryInnovation #ConstructionCulture #FutureOfConstruction  Connect with our Host and Guest!   • Episode 58: Greg Peters - Innovating Construction's Future | The Competitive Contractor Podcast
    Dive into the world of robotics and automation with Greg Peters, a visionary at the forefront of hardware innovation in construction. As Principal Product Engineer and Robotics & Automation Lead at Laing O'Rourke Australia, Peters shares his expert insights on how cutting-edge technologies are reshaping safety, productivity, and the skill landscape of the industry. Throughout the episode, Peters follows the evolution of mechanical automation up to the advanced utilisation of robotics in order to tackle complex construction problems. All these extended down to the use of tunnel boring machines to the innovative concept of swarm robotics for smaller construction tasks, with a discussion highlighting massive strides being taken to enhance efficiency and safety in the field. This episode serves as an important resource for industry leaders looking to plot their way through the dynamic intersection of technology and traditional methods, aiming to foster a more innovative, safe, and efficient construction environment.   #RoboticsInConstruction #HardwareInnovation #AutomationTechnology #SafetyAndProductivity #SwarmRobotics #ConstructionIndustry #InnovativeTechnology #EfficiencyInConstruction #CuttingEdgeTechnologies #ConstructionAutomation Connect with our Host and Guest!   • Episode 57: Kylie Yates - Civil Contractors and Future of Work | The Competitive Contractor Podcast
    Explore the future of the civil construction industry. This episode delves into the challenges posed by economic pressures, high material costs, and the ambitious target to construct 377,000 new homes in New South Wales by 2029.   Kylie Yates, CEO of the Civil Contractors Federation NSW (CCF NSW), sheds light on the necessity for streamlined procurement processes and effective resource coordination.  She also highlights successful diversity initiatives and examines potential industry changes, including integrating renewable energy and advanced technologies. Listen in to learn how civil contractors can navigate and capitalise on these transformations to thrive in an evolving landscape.  #CivilConstruction #FutureOfWork #InfrastructureDevelopment #DiversityInConstruction  Connect with our Host and Guest!   • Episode 56: Nicholas Proud - The Missing Link | The Competitive Contractor Podcast
    Venture into the critical role of civil contractors in shaping Australia's future infrastructure and housing landscape. This episode highlights the intricate relationship between housing and civil infrastructure, articulating the "missing link" that ensures successful community planning and sustainability. Nicholas Proud, CEO of the Civil Contractors Federation, explores the essential contributions of the civil construction sector to community development. He also emphasises the recent national initiatives and forums where civil contractors' voices are amplified, focusing on pressing issues such as the housing crisis and the importance of foundational civil works required for the new developments. Listen in as Nicholas and Shivendra tackle the challenges of skills shortages and workplace culture in the civil sector, advocating for strategic changes to foster a robust workforce capable of meeting Australia’s infrastructure needs. #CommunityDevelopment #Infrastructure #CivilConstruction #Engineering #ConstructionPodcast #CompetitiveContractorPodcast Connect with our Host and Guest!
